Manila, April 8 -- The Bukidnon provincial government on Wednesday launched a Task Force on Petroleum and Energy Resiliency (TF-PER) to draft a contingency plan to mitigate the impact of oil price hikes driven by Middle East tensions.
In a statement, TF-PER chairperson and Provincial Board Member Oliver Owen Garcia said the task force's plan will ensure that the provincial government's basic services continue to operate amid the country's state of energy emergency.
"We will have more meetings with provincial executive officers and local government leaders for this plan to align its mandates," he said.
